Starting a new build, 26x26x18 cube and have a 24x24x16 sump built. I want to move about 1000gph I'm thinking through the sump. It will e sps dominant, and I am going pretty high end on equipment. I am thinking single drain, with a secondary emergency drain, and then a single return pump that will split into 2 pipes near the top to add more directional flow.
I am looking to do this DIY, and have done my last tank This way but want it to look clean and have all the pipes within the overflow drilled throuh the bottom so the cube sits flush with the wall. I am thinking 1 inch drain and 1 inch return, but am not enitely sure if this is sufficient in size. I have also seen multiple methods to minimize noise, but don't really know what's best?

Good feedback thanks, I will plan on pre ordering a ticket it sounds like!I went last year, there are lots of nice corals at decent price.
Lots of individual vendors with unique collections there.
The best always gone the first few hours of show opening, killer deals will start a few hours before closing.
When you see something affordable you like to purchase get it immediately because it may not be there the second time around.
